The wallpaper community, especially within the iDB Wallpapers of the Week gallery, could not be more excited about how the new iOS 26 Lock Screen interacts with background design. While earlier version of iOS allowed for Depth Effect back to iOS 16, the combination of Liquid Glass and scalable clock typeface double down on the interactivity between the image and iOS elements.
